iD Tech Camps came to us looking for a comprehensive social media design and marketing package. Over the course of three weeks, Pearse Street designed the official MySpace page to promote their edgy and tech-themed “Basement” web page. This multi-faceted design set the tone for customizating the Twitter, MySpace, Facebook and Basement website pages.
With these microsites in place, Pearse Street commenced a Phase 2 marketing campaign, including a MySpace friend campaign and the development of a viral Facebook application featuring multi-media feeds from Flickr, YouTube and official iD Tech Camps blog, and generating alumnae badges for former students.

The new media office at Shady Records contacted us to create a professional MySpace design for Eminem’s famous Detroit-based band, D12. Pearse Street decided this was to be the mother of all MySpace pages. We put our design skills and tech-knowledge in high gear to build an interactive Flash flipbook featuring each band member, with a special tribute to late member, Proof.
Pearse Street stayed true to the almost gothic quality of the D12 style, straying from the popular hip hop “bling” and representing the down and dirty visuals of the city streets. Behind the scenes, this custom MySpace layout is updating by a fully-customized content management system that allows text and audio updates to be made through an admin panel independent of MySpace. This project lead the way for Pearse Street’s subsequent work with Shady Records’ parent company Interscope Records. Pearse Street was hired to design a series of interactive Flash banners to use in a viral marketing campaign promoting the Re-Up album. These banners can be found on the various MySpace pages and websites of the following artists: Eminem, 50 Cent, D12, Bobby Creekwater, Lloyd Banks, Shady Records, Ca$his, and Stat Quo. In two months these banners received over 5 million views, which all considered a great success!
